Solana rethink at Palmitas-2
By Upstream staff
Latin American player Solana Resources said the Palmitas-2 well on the Guachiria Sur block in Colombia’s Llanos Basin would be suspended for further evaluation after testing of the cased hole failed to yield commercial amounts of oil.
London- and Calgary-listed Solana said initial logging had suggested potential oil pay in the Carbonera C-7 formation, subsequent tests had not borne this out.
It said further testing of the well would need specialised tools that are not available in Colombia at present.
Solana operates the Guachiria Sur block with a 100% stake. Lewis Energy Colombia holds the remaining 30%.
The company said it remained committed to exploration on the Llanos block and would spud the Los Aceites-1 well 3.3 kilometres south-west of the Palmitas-2 site.
